Amphenol's Stellar Q3 Propels Stock to New Heights, Full-Year Forecast Strengthens

Unveiling Stellar Third Quarter Performance

Amphenol Corporation recently announced its fiscal third-quarter results for 2025, revealing a period of exceptional financial growth that immediately boosted investor confidence and sent its stock price upwards. The company's sales figures saw a remarkable surge, climbing by 53% compared to the previous year, to reach an impressive $6.19 billion. This substantial revenue significantly surpassed the $5.53 billion consensus forecast from financial analysts, demonstrating robust market demand for Amphenol's offerings.

Drivers Behind Remarkable Growth and Profitability

The impressive sales increase was primarily fueled by strong organic expansion across nearly all of Amphenol's diverse end markets. Particularly noteworthy was the exceptional organic growth observed within the IT datacom sector, signaling strong demand in critical technology infrastructure. Complementing this organic momentum were the strategic contributions from the company's successful acquisition initiatives, which have clearly integrated well and added substantial value. Furthermore, adjusted ear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ter stood at 93 cents, comfortably exceeding the analyst projection of 80 cents, underscoring efficient operations and strong financial health. The adjusted operating margin also reached an all-time high of 27.5%, a significant improvement from 21.9% in the prior year, reflecting enhanced operational efficiency and cost management.

Solid Financial Foundation and Shareholder Returns

As of September 30, 2025, Amphenol maintained a strong liquidity position, holding $3.89 billion in cash and equivalent assets. In a move to reward its shareholders, the company actively repurchased 1.4 million shares of its common stock during the second quarter, investing $153 million. Additionally, it distributed $201 million in dividends, totaling approximately $354 million returned to shareholders through these capital allocation strategies. Demonstrating further commitment to shareholder value, Amphenol's Board of Directors approved a substantial 52% increase in its quarterly dividend, raising it from $0.165 to $0.25 per share. This enhanced dividend is scheduled for payment on January 7, 2026, to shareholders registered by December 16, 2025.

Optimistic Forecast for the Fourth Quarter and Full Year

Looking ahead, Amphenol has provided an optimistic outlook, projecting fourth-quarter sales to fall within the range of $6.000 billion to $6.100 billion. This forecast represents a significant year-over-year increase of 39% to 41%, comfortably exceeding the street's expectation of $5.695 billion. The company also anticipates adjusted EPS for the fourth quarter to be between $0.89 and $0.91, marking a substantial 62% to 65% increase from the previous year and surpassing the analyst consensus of 80 cents. For the entire fiscal year 2025, Amphenol has raised its sales guidance to between $22.660 billion and $22.760 billion, implying a 49% to 50% year-over-year growth. Market Reaction and Future Prospects

The positive financial results and revised guidance were met with an enthusiastic response from the market, as Amphenol's stock (APH) saw an 8.33% increase, reaching $134.80 during Wednesday's trading session. This significant upward movement underscores investor confidence in the company's strategic direction, robust growth trajectory, and sustained profitability.
